require 'spec_helper'
describe 'user self registration', type: :feature, js: true do
let(:admin) { FactoryBot.create :admin, password: 'Test123Test123', password_confirmation: 'Test123Test123' }
let(:home_page) { Pages::Home.new }
context 'with "manual account activation"' do
before do
allow(Setting)
.to receive(:self_registration?)
.and_return true
end
it 'allows self registration on login page (Regression #28076)' do
visit signin_path
click_link 'Create a new account'
# deliberately inserting a wrong password confirmation
within '.registration-modal' do
fill_in 'Login', with: 'heidi'
fill_in 'First name', with: 'Heidi'
fill_in 'Last name', with: 'Switzerland'
fill_in 'Email', with: 'heidi@heidiland.com'
fill_in 'Password', with: 'test123=321test'
fill_in 'Confirmation', with: 'test123=321test'
click_button 'Create'
end
expect(page)
.to have_content('Your account was created and is now pending administrator approval.')
end
it 'allows self registration and activation by an admin' do
home_page.visit!
# registration as an anonymous user
within '.top-menu-items-right .menu_root' do
click_link 'Sign in'
# Wait until click handler has been initialized
sleep(0.1)
click_link 'Create a new account'
end
# deliberately inserting a wrong password confirmation
within '.registration-modal' do
fill_in 'Login', with: 'heidi'
fill_in 'First name', with: 'Heidi'
fill_in 'Last name', with: 'Switzerland'
fill_in 'Email', with: 'heidi@heidiland.com'
fill_in 'Password', with: 'test123=321test'
fill_in 'Confirmation', with: 'something different'
click_button 'Create'
end
expect(page)
.to have_content('Confirmation doesn\'t match Password')
# correcting password
within '.registration-modal' do
# Cannot use 'Password' here as the error message on 'Confirmation' is part of the label
# and contains the string 'Password' as well
fill_in 'user_password', with: 'test123=321test'
fill_in 'Confirmation', with: 'test123=321test'
click_button 'Create'
end
expect(page)
.to have_content('Your account was created and is now pending administrator approval.')
registered_user = User.find_by(status: Principal::STATUSES[:registered])
# Trying unsuccessfully to login
login_with 'heidi', 'test123=321test'
expect(page)
.to have_content I18n.t(:'account.error_inactive_manual_activation')
# activation as admin
login_with admin.login, admin.password
user_page = Pages::Admin::Users::Edit.new(registered_user.id)
user_page.visit!
user_page.activate!
expect(page)
.to have_content('Successful update.')
logout
# Test logging in as newly created and activated user
login_with 'heidi', 'test123=321test'
within '.top-menu-items-right .menu_root' do
expect(page)
.to have_selector("a[title='#{registered_user.name}']")
end
end
end
end
